区块链钱包搭建费用详解:从设计到实现的全面
引言
在数字货币风起云涌的今天,区块链钱包成为了不可或缺的工具。无论是作为投资手段还是日常消费,了解如何搭建一个安全高效的区块链钱包已经成为许多企业和个人关注的焦点。然而,搭建区块链钱包的费用并非轻而易举可以估算的,本文将深入分析搭建费用的构成要素,并提供相关的实用洞见。
区块链钱包的基础知识
在讨论搭建费用之前,我们需要首先理解什么是区块链钱包。简而言之,区块链钱包是一种数字工具,用于存储和管理加密货币的私钥,用户通过这些私钥进行交易。根据使用模式的不同,区块链钱包分为热钱包(在线)和冷钱包(离线)。热钱包方便快捷,适合频繁交易;而冷钱包则安全性更高,适合长期存储。
区块链钱包搭建的费用构成
区块链钱包的搭建费用主要分为几个方面:
1. 设计和规划阶段
在搭建钱包之前,您需要进行详细的设计和规划。这个阶段通常包括用户体验设计、界面设计以及需求分析。根据项目的复杂程度,费用可能从几千美元到几万美元不等。
2. 开发阶段
开发是搭建区块链钱包最重要的一环。这个阶段包括前端和后端的开发、钱包功能的实现(如创建和恢复钱包、发送和接收加密货币等)。根据开发团队的技术水平和地理位置,这部分的费用差异很大,通常在几千到几万美金之间。
3. 测试阶段
无论是哪个软件开发项目,测试都是至关重要的环节。在测试阶段,开发者需要确保钱包的安全性和稳定性。这个阶段的费用通常取决于测试的深度和复杂性,可能需要几千到一万美元。
4. 上线和维护阶段
上线后,您还需要考虑钱包的运营和维护费用。这包括服务器费用、日常维护费用以及根据用户反馈进行升级的费用。年度费用可能在几百到几千美元不等。
如何降低区块链钱包的搭建费用
若希望降低搭建费用,可以考虑以下几个策略:
- 选择合适的开发团队:选择技术过硬且资费合理的开发团队。
- 利用现有的开源项目:许多开源区块链钱包可以作为基础进行修改和扩展,从而节省时间和成本。
- 简化设计:在初期可以优先实现核心功能,后续再进行设计的和扩展。
常见问题解答
1. 什么是区块链钱包,为什么要搭建一个?
区块链钱包是用户存储和管理加密货币的重要工具,搭建钱包的原因主要包括:个人资产管理、企业内部交易、增强安全性和私密性等。搭建一个钱包使用户能够直接控制自己的资金,而不依赖于第三方平台的信任。
2. 搭建一个区块链钱包需要多长时间?
搭建区块链钱包的时间取决于多种因素,如功能复杂度、团队规模及技术水平等。通常,简单的钱包可能需要1-3个月的开发时间,而复杂的项目可能需要数月甚至一年的时间。关键在于精准的需求定位与高效的团队协作。
3. 区块链钱包的安全性如何保障?
钱包的安全性是至关重要的,开发者可以通过多种方式来增强安全性,例如使用多重签名技术、加密存储用户私钥、定期进行安全审计等。此外,用户也应提升自身的安全意识,定期更新软件以及使用强密码。
4. 当前市场上有哪些主流的区块链钱包解决方案?
市场上有几种主流的钱包解决方案包括: - 热钱包(如MetaMask、Trust Wallet) - 冷钱包(如Ledger、Trezor) - 企业钱包(如Coinbase Custody)。这些钱包各有优劣,用户需要根据自身需求来选择合适的解决方案。
总结
搭建一个区块链钱包是一项复杂的任务,其费用的构成也较为复杂。然而,通过深入的分析和合理的规划,尤其是在设计、开发、测试和推出阶段中,您将能够更好地控制这些费用,并确保钱包的安全性与功能性。希望本文能够为您提供有价值的信息,帮助您做出明智的选择。
(以上是内容框架示例,具体细节可以根据读者需求进行调整和补充,遵守基础的结构与要求,扩充至3000字也可进一步细化各个部分的内容。)